What to Look for in a Car Trash Can
Size & Capacity
Car trash cans range from compact cup-holder inserts (about 1 liter) to larger hanging models (3β5 liters). For solo commuters, a small cup-holder size is usually sufficient. Families or rideshare drivers will want a larger hanging or console-mounted option. The key is finding the largest size that doesn't intrude on passenger space or driving comfort.
Mounting Style
There are four main mounting options, each with trade-offs:
- Cup holder insert: Fits in your existing cup holder. Compact and portable but limited capacity.
- Headrest hanger: Hangs from the back of the front seat headrest. Great for rear passengers and families with kids.
- Console-mounted: Sits between the front seats. Easy access for the driver but takes up console space.
- Visor clip: Clips to the sun visor. Ultra-compact, best for minimal trash like receipts and wrappers.
Leak-Proof Design
This is non-negotiable. A car trash can without a leak-proof liner or waterproof interior is an accident waiting to happen. Look for models with a waterproof inner lining or a removable, washable insert. Some premium models include a sealed lid to contain odors as well.
Liner Compatibility
The best car trash cans are designed to work with standard small trash bags or include their own reusable liners. This makes emptying effortless β pull out the bag, toss it, replace it. Models that require proprietary liners or are difficult to empty will get abandoned quickly.
Material & Aesthetics
Your car trash can should complement your interior, not clash with it. Popular materials include:
- Oxford cloth: Soft, flexible, and available in neutral colors that blend with most interiors.
- ABS plastic: Rigid, easy to wipe clean, and more durable long-term.
- Silicone: Flexible, collapsible, and completely waterproof β ideal for liquid spills.
- Leather or faux leather: Premium look for luxury vehicle owners who want everything to match.

Tips for Keeping Your Car Consistently Clean
- Empty it every time you fill up gas. Tying trash disposal to an existing habit makes it automatic.
- Keep a small pack of trash bags in the glove box so you can re-line immediately after emptying.
- Add a car-safe deodorizer near the trash can to neutralize odors between empties.
- Set a rule: nothing goes on the floor or in the cup holder that belongs in the trash. One rule, enforced consistently, keeps the whole system working.
- For families: give each passenger their own small bag at the start of every trip. Kids respond well to having their own designated space.
